This training prepares participants to become Grief Healing Coaches and emphasizes the special responsibility involved in guiding people through their grieving process. The program begins with the fundamentals of grief and explores different forms of loss — from the death of a loved one to the loss of identity or dreams. Grief is not viewed as a problem to be solved, but as a process that can be lived through and acknowledged. The training introduces the Grief Healing Method, a five-step approach: acceptance of the new reality, forgiveness (of yourself and others), letting go of the past, creating a new life, and experiencing joy and presence. Each step is supported by scientific insights and practical coaching tools, with a strong focus on presence, non-judgmental listening, and the power of silence. Coaches learn how to build trust, maintain professional boundaries, and create a safe environment for their clients. In addition, the program addresses ethical guidelines, self-care for coaches, and the importance of visibility and authentic marketing to reach people in grief. Practical session structures, powerful coaching questions, and common pitfalls are discussed to ensure effective and empathetic guidance. Ultimately, the training positions the coach not as a problem solver, but as a guide and mirror — someone who creates space for healing, transformation, and new meaning in life after loss.
